Meat & Seafood Department

Fresh Alaskan Halibut is a favorite amongst our customers here at Bentley’s Market. Halibut from the North Pacific’s icy waters are prized for its delicate sweet flavor, snow-white color and firm flaky meat. It is an excellent source of high quality protein and minerals, low in sodium, fat and calories.

 

Pacific Halibut is caught in a responsible, renewable fishery by long line in the Northern Pacific, greatly minimizing the accidental by-catch.  Fresh Alaskan Halibut Steaks are favorites for Broiling & Grilling while Alaskan Halibut Filets are usually Poached or Baked.
